Sell the ones you care least about and get all the rest fixed.
If you restore a synth with new capacitors and all they should last a long time before other major repairs.

New stuff may have a warranty but it foesn't mean it won't break, plus some new stuff is pretty low quality/high priced compared to vintage gear.
